Output 76729ffe10259fe7eea6718cfda49a9d02c7434c2e212dc253c3efeead0dba04:1

value
298199663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d05da506c40c910ff33b916e0841912f26f950 OP_EQUAL
address
37saouVqBrJzxAq78g6WNYqPbyLjELUjCU
transaction
76729ffe10259fe7eea6718cfda49a9d02c7434c2e212dc253c3efeead0dba04
confirmations
530979
spent
true